Position Description:
Leads a high-performing team responsible for delivering high quality data analysis and visualizations by reporting on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and revenue reconciliations. Queries data using Alteryx, Tableau, Visual Basic, R, SQL, and Data Visualization tools. Develops technical solutions to navigate the complex Medicare network of decisions and builds business solutions to meet the needs of Medicare beneficiaries. Drives organizational initiatives that aim to grow organizational scale and efficiency through an enhanced carrier commission reconciliation strategy. Designs monthly reporting routines on domain KPI's across a distributed team consisting of multiple functions.
